Found: Klinggon Headphone Cable Management for Athletes
Klinggon is an upstart company that’s wrapped up its Kickstarter campaign and is in the midst of production of their dual-shot injection molded cord catcher for athletes.
Really, the pic tells the functional story as well as anything, close ups of the product are after the break. It’s a two-piece unit that uses strong neodymium magnets to hold itself in place on your jersey, shirt or whatever. The front piece uses a harder plastic base with softer, grippier silicone to hold the cable snugly.
Retail should be about $30, and they’re targeting late August/early September availability.
The back piece is smooth, so it shouldn’t rub you the wrong way. For cyclists, this could keep your dangling headphone cord from catching on the stem or constantly rubbing your knee.
